FE08 LFT is a 2008 Renault Megane in Silver with a 1,461c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 26 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.7%.

Across all 2008 Renault Megane models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.2% with a typical mileage of 67,006 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Renault Megane f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 358,622 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FE08 LFT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Renault Megane typ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 18 years old, this Renault Megane is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
